There are about 600 environmental cases pending at the U.S. Justice Department, of which 58 involve bankruptcy issues. Thus, nearly 10 percent of our case docket forces us to confront the interaction of bankruptcy and environmental law.

In response, we have had to hire bankruptcy experts. We now have a senior attorney who is responsible for ensuring that we take consistent positions in all of those cases.

 

Nancy Firestone is Deputy Section Chief for Environmental Enforcement, Land and Natural Resources Division, U.S. Department of Justice in Washington, DC.
